Payroll Manager (Los Angeles)
Nossaman LLP is seeking an experienced Payroll Manager to oversee the Firm's payroll operations in a complex multi-state environment and serve as a strategic partner to Finance, Talent Management, and Firm leadership.
This is an exceptional opportunity for a payroll professional who thrives on ownership, accuracy, problem-solving, and continuous improvement. The role is hybrid (onsite 2+ days per week), based in the Finance department in the Firm's Los Angeles office. The Payroll Manager is responsible for all aspects of payroll administration for a national law firm, ensuring compliance, operational excellence, and an outstanding employee experience.
We are seeking a payroll professional who views payroll as a critical business function and takes pride in delivering accurate, timely, and compliant payroll services while continuously improving processes and controls. The ideal candidate combines technical payroll expertise with strong business judgment, exceptional service skills, and a commitment to operational excellence. This is a hands-on leadership role with end-to-end responsibility for payroll operations across the Firm, including oversight of a Payroll Analyst.
The salary range for the position of Payroll Manager at Nossaman is $125,000 to $130,000 annually. The successful candidate's salary for this position is reasonably expected to be set within this range. However, actual compensation will depend on a variety of factors, including, without limitation, the candidate's qualifications and experience.
Key ResponsibilitiesPayroll Administration
- Manage and process all Firm payrolls, including biweekly and monthly payrolls, partner distributions, bonus payrolls, off-cycle payments, and final pay calculations.
- Ensure payroll is processed accurately, timely, and in compliance with federal, state, and local regulations.
- Research, troubleshoot, and resolve payroll discrepancies and complex payroll issues.
- Review and audit payroll data, year-to-date balances, employee records, tax withholdings, and payroll adjustments.
- Administer and oversee complex payroll transactions and special processing scenarios, including unique compensation payments, employee-specific payroll arrangements, and other non-routine payroll activities requiring independent analysis and resolution.
- Maintain payroll schedules, deduction records, garnishments, and other payroll-related transactions.
- Supervise and support payroll Analyst, providing day-to-day direction, quality control, workload coordination, cross-training, and knowledge sharing to ensure accurate, timely, and compliant payroll processing and adequate business continuity.
Systems & Process Management
- Serve as the Firm's payroll systems expert, with primary responsibility for ADP Workforce Now.
- Maintain payroll-related data within the Firm's HRIS and ensure the integrity and accuracy of employee records.
- Lead payroll setup, testing, and configuration activities associated with new entities, company codes, organizational changes, and other payroll expansion initiatives.
- Monitor payroll-related integrations and data feeds to ensure accurate information flow between systems.
- Identify and implement process improvements, automation opportunities, and best practices to enhance efficiency and accuracy.
- Create, maintain, and continuously improve payroll procedures, process documentation, and desk manuals to support consistency, knowledge transfer, and operational continuity.
- Partner with Finance and Talent Management leadership on payroll-related projects and system enhancements.
Financial Reporting & Reconciliations
- Reconcile payroll activity to the general ledger and partner closely with Accounting to ensure accurate and timely financial reporting.
- Maintain and validate payroll earnings, deductions, taxes, benefits, and partner distribution codes, including the associated general ledger mappings, to ensure proper accounting treatment and reporting.
- Review payroll-related journal entries, account reconciliations, and supporting schedules, investigating and resolving discrepancies as needed.
- Prepare and distribute payroll, management, compliance, and ad hoc reports to support Firm leadership and operational decision-making.
- Analyze payroll data and trends, providing meaningful reporting and insights to Finance leadership.
- Coordinate payroll-related wire transfers and funding requirements with Accounts Payable.
- Support month-end and year-end close activities by ensuring payroll transactions are accurately recorded, reconciled, and reported.
- Support and maintain payroll-related internal controls, ensuring compliance with Firm policies, audit requirements, and accounting standards.
- Collaborate with Finance, Accounting, and Talent Management teams on payroll system enhancements, reporting improvements, internal controls, and process efficiencies.
Retirement Plans, Compliance & Audits
- Process and reconcile 401(k) contributions and related reporting.
- Serve as the primary liaison with retirement plan administrators and support annual plan testing and compliance requirements.
- Lead payroll support for annual retirement plan compliance processes, including Year End Compliance Information (YECI) reporting, payroll and compensation data validation, preparation of census and compliance reports, coordination with retirement plan administrators, and support for employer contribution and profit-sharing calculations and funding activities.

- Support year-end payroll activities, including W-2 review and distribution and compilation of information required for K-1 reporting.
- Maintain annual payroll system configurations and regulatory updates, including retirement plan contribution limits, payroll tax updates, and other payroll-related compliance changes.
- Prepare and support various regulatory and compliance reporting requirements, including ACA, EEO, and other government filings.
Employee Support
- Serve as the primary point of contact for payroll-related inquiries.
- Provide exceptional service and timely support to attorneys, business professionals, and firm leadership.
- Process income and employment verification requests while maintaining strict confidentiality.
QualificationsRequired
-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, Business Administration, Human Resources, or a related field,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
- Five or more years of progressively responsible payroll experience in a mid-sized or large organization.
- Experience processing payroll in a multi-state environment, including knowledge of varying state payroll, tax, and wage-and-hour requirements.
- Extensive hands-on experience with ADP Workforce Now, including payroll processing, reporting, system administration, workflow management, and troubleshooting payroll-related issues.
- Strong knowledge of payroll tax regulations, payroll accounting principles, general ledger mapping, reconciliations, wage and hour laws, deductions, garnishments, and payroll compliance requirements.
- Experience managing year-end payroll reporting, tax filings, reconciliations, and payroll-related audits.
- Demonstrated ability to manage multiple priorities while consistently meeting deadlines with a high degree of accuracy.
- Demonstrated ability to exercise sound judgment and maintain confidentiality when handling sensitive compensation, payroll, benefit, and personnel information.
- Previous experience supervising, mentoring, or training payroll staff.
- Knowledge of partner compensation, partner distributions, and K-1 reporting.
- Experience with payroll accounting, general ledger reconciliations, and financial reporting.
Preferred
- Experience in a law firm or other professional services environment.
- Advanced Excel skills, including Power Query, pivot tables, lookups, formulas, and data analysis.
- Certified Payroll Professional (CPP) designation or progress toward obtaining certification.
- ADP Workforce Now certification.
- Experience leading payroll system implementations, upgrades, integrations, or significant process improvement initiatives.
